Francis Godolphin Osbourne Stuart's "Gezicht op de Royal Pier van Southampton, Engeland" (1881-1910) is a black and white photograph showcasing a panoramic view of the Royal Pier in Southampton, England. The image captures a bustling scene with numerous ships and boats docked at the pier, while people stroll along its promenade. Stuart's work, a testament to the rise of photographic documentation in the late 19th century, provides a glimpse into the vibrant maritime life of the era. The photograph's high vantage point offers a sweeping perspective, emphasizing the pier's grand scale and the city's connection to the sea.
